HR 160 Louisiana House · 2026 Regular Session

PROPERTY: Authorizes and requests the Louisiana State Law Institute to study provisions regarding transfer of property

This resolution directs the Louisiana State Law Institute to study how property transfers interact with the public records doctrine and a specific 1993 court ruling known as Simmesport State Bank v. Roy. The study aims to address practical legal issues where a court decision may negatively impact good-faith property buyers who rely on recorded documents. The legislature has requested that the institute provide its findings and recommendations to the House of Representatives by January 4, 2027. This measure does not change any laws immediately but instead initiates a formal review to guide potential future legislation.
